← ScienceWhich outcome occurs when a SQUID’s Josephson junction exceeds critical current?
A)Abrupt transition to normal conductivity✓
B)Quantum entanglement becomes decoherent
C)Increased sensitivity to magnetic fields
D)Enhanced energy gap within superconductor
💡 Explanation
Exceeding critical current in a SQUID forces a transition because the Cooper pairs break apart via current-induced depairing, disrupting *superconductivity*. Therefore, normal conductivity is restored, rather than sensitivity increasing due to maintained Cooper pair coherence.
